On today's Episode of BRC and Friends, I sit down with Alissa Charles-Findley, sister of Botham Jean and the author of the book, “After Botham: Healing from My Brother's Murder by a Police Officer.” Not only do we talk about the death of her brother and her work with other families who have lost loved ones to police violence, we talk about writing, parenting, and what keeps us whole in times of struggle.
